T-BOW® Postural Course | Beginner / 6 hours (1 day)


Contents: 

The Postural T-BOW® philosophy provides unique resources to facilitate and enrich the acquisition of postures and postural sequences from a holistic perspective of personalized optimization.


The postural repertoire stems from Sandra Bonacina's experience with T-BOW® in physiotherapy and movement training (University of Zurich, since 1995) and is enriched with contributions from yoga, artistic gymnastics, dance, weightlifting and martial arts. All resources are based on the concepts and practical proposals for movement education and training learned from the master Francisco Seirul·lo Vargas (University of Barcelona, ​​since 1986). Each person optimizes their postures through a personalized interaction of cognitive, coordinative, conditional, socio-affective, emotional-volitional, expressive-creative, bioenergetic, and mental factors.


The unique characteristics of T-BOW®: (a) facilitate the acquisition of postures in people with significant limitations in balance, strength, or flexibility; and (b) enrich the postural challenges for all types of practitioners, from beginners to elite athletes.


The essence of Postural T-BOW® consists of static postures, very slow dynamic postures, and postural sequences with a predominance of static postures. Dynamic postures at different speeds—that is, general and specific dynamic coordination—complete the static-dynamic optimization of the entire human movement development.

Goal:

Learn postural optimization techniques with the T-BOW® to facilitate, enrich, and expand static postures, very slow dynamic postures, and postural sequences with a predominance of static postures, as fundamental pillars of static-dynamic optimization of all human movement.


Areas of application of the Postural T-BOW®:

a) Hygienic-re-educative perspective: postural health for daily life, work activity, and the re-education of postural alterations.

b) Expressive-creative perspective: posture for motor performance without injury, posture for expressive motor performance, and posture for personal aesthetics.

c) Educational perspective: postural education oriented towards personal improvement for life.
